n-Propyl Bromide from Mexico
n-Propyl bromide (CH3CH2CH2Br), also known as 1-bromopropane, is an alkyl bromide serving as a solvent and intermediate in agrochemical and pharmaceutical manufacturing. Classified under HTS 2903.69.10.00 as a brominated acyclic hydrocarbon alkyl bromide, excluding methyl bromide. It meets Chapter 29 criteria for chemically defined halogenated compounds.
